VA Loans in Arkansas

VA loans are designed to provide long-term financing for American veterans. Issued by federally qualified lenders like USA Mortgage and guaranteed by the U.S. Veterans Administration, these loans help make homeownership more accessible. The VA determines eligibility and issues a certificate to qualified applicants, which they can submit to their mortgage lender of choice. VA home loans come with an upfront funding fee, which can be financed into the loan. Even with a $0 down payment, there is no mortgage insurance cost added to the monthly payment. Additionally, the VA offers financing options for qualified energy-efficient home upgrades, whether you’re purchasing or refinancing a home.

Benefits of VA Loan in Arkansas

VA loans in Arkansas offer valuable benefits for veterans, active-duty service members, and their families. No matter where you’re planning to buy a home in the state, we provide expert guidance and full support throughout the loan process.

  • No Down Payment: Unlike conventional loans that require a percentage of the home price upfront, VA loans offer 100% financing.
  • No Monthly Mortgage Insurance (PMI): Conventional and FHA loans require mortgage insurance, but VA loans do not.
  • Competitive Interest Rates: VA loans often come with lower interest rates compared to conventional mortgages.
  • Flexible Credit Requirements: VA loans are more lenient regarding credit scores and debt-to-income (DTI) ratios.
  • No Prepayment Penalty: You can pay off your loan early without financial penalties.

Arkansas VA Loan Requirements

To qualify for a VA loan in Arkansas, applicants must meet at least one of the following criteria:

  • 90 days of service during wartime.
  • 181 days of continuous service during peacetime.
  • 6 years of service in the National Guard or Reserves.
  • Being an unremarried surviving spouse of a service member who died in the line of duty or from a service-connected disability.

Additionally, VA loans must be used for a primary residence, and a one-time VA funding fee may apply.

What credit score is needed for a VA loan in Arkansas?

VA loans have more flexible credit requirements than conventional loans. While the VA itself does not set a minimum score, most lenders prefer a credit score of at least 580-620.
